The NI PCI-6519 is a high-performance, rugged digital I/O interface designed specifically to meet the demanding requirements of the power industry, petrochemical sector, and general automation applications. Engineered by NI, a leader in automation solutions, this module excels in providing reliable, high-speed digital input/output capabilities that ensure precision, durability, and seamless integration into complex automation systems.
At its core, the NI PCI-6519 offers 96 digital lines organized into 3 ports, delivering versatile input/output capacity that supports both TTL and open-collector configurations. Its robust design is tailored for industrial environments, ensuring sustained operation even under harsh conditions frequently encountered in power plants, petrochemical facilities, and automated manufacturing lines. The card's PCI interface facilitates high-throughput data transfer rates, achieving swift communication with the host PC for real-time control and monitoring tasks. With signal conditioning optimized for noise immunity and enhanced ESD protection, the PCI-6519 guarantees reliable performance across extensive operational cycles.
In practical scenarios, the NI PCI-6519 shines in applications requiring extensive digital control and monitoring. In the power industry, it can be employed for real-time status monitoring of circuit breakers, transformer tap changers, and relay logic controls. Its 96 digital lines enable simultaneous management of multiple signals, reducing system complexity and wiring overhead. Within petrochemical plants, the PCI-6519 supports safety interlocks and process control sequences, ensuring rapid response to critical events and enhancing operational safety. For general automation, it facilitates large-scale machine control, conveyor system management, and digital signaling in factory automation setups, delivering the responsiveness and reliability that process engineers demand.
